MH Hospitality is seeking a motivated and results-driven Director of Sales to join the team at Staybridge Suites Kansas City. This is a hands-on role focused on driving revenue, building strong client relationships, and supporting overall hotel sales efforts. This position reports directly to the General Manager and works closely with hotel leadership to grow business and increase occupancy.
